Whereas a typical bed is completely level, a healthcare facility bed enables the person or their caretaker to readjust the head and foot sections separately ahead to a semi-seated placement or elevate the legs or knees (Hospital Beds For Home Use). This is an essential function for clients who will certainly be spending a considerable quantity of time in bedThe ability to increase the head and back to a semi-sitting position is useful when the client desires to watch TV or hang around with visitors. The upper panel can then be reduced once more, allowing the client to rest conveniently. Medical facility beds, or adjustable clinical beds, are made with hefty use in mind.

While two individuals can oversleep a regular bed, health center beds are made to be used by one person at a time. In a healthcare facility setup, this is suitable due to the fact that it gives registered nurses full access to each client. Nonetheless, in a home setup, couples may wish to rest with each other. If the person will just require the medical facility bed temporarily while recovering from a health problem or surgery, sleeping alone may not be a substantial concern and might be the most effective method to keep the person secure.

Medicare Part B (Medical Insurance policy) covers medical facility beds as long lasting clinical devices (DME) that your physician recommends for usage in your house. After you meet the Component B deductible you pay 20% of the Medicare-approved quantity (if your vendor accepts job - Hospital Beds For Home Use. Medicare spends for various type of DME in different means.

You might need to purchase the equipment. It's likewise vital to ask a distributor if they take part in Medicare prior to you get DME.

By elevating the bed up, it additionally helps prevent back stress and injury for carers when executing on the bed treatment. There are some medical facility beds that have an incredibly reduced elevation, generally referred to as floor beds. The reduced height significantly lowers the danger of injury from bed falls.
